From the publisher
Her Origin Story is a podcast about the messy, magical beginnings of bold women who turned their ideas into impact. Hosted by storytelling coach Toby Myles, each episode features a real, unfiltered conversation with a female founder, creator, or changemaker about what sparked their journey. These aren’t highlight-reel success stories, they’re intimate looks at the first steps, the turning points, and the hard-earned lessons that shaped each woman’s path. Whether you're building a business, thinking about starting something new, or simply love a story that goes beyond the surface, this show is here to remind you: every powerful brand starts with a powerful origin story. Ep 48Crafting Your Hopeful Future: Toby Myles & Erika Andersen on True Transformation Made Easier
Check Out These Highlights: Erika Andersen’s origin story begins with a childhood shaped by feminist parents and suffragist grandmothers, instilling a belief in possibility and independence. After pursuing music and spending nearly a decade in an ashram, Erika discovered her calling in organizational transformation; eventually founding Proteus in 1990. In this episode, Erika explains why having a clear mission and vision is critical for entrepreneurs, how self-talk can quiet the “white noise” of anxiety, and why transformation must be rooted in authenticity rather than outside prescriptions. She also shares how Proteus pivoted during the pandemic and why true success comes from helping people become who they want to become. Listeners will walk away with practical insights on resilience, clarity, and building businesses that align with their deepest purpose. About Erika Andersen: Erika is a leadership expert, bestselling author, and founding partner of Proteus. For over 35 years, she has helped CEOs and companies like Spotify, Amazon, and Charter Spectrum grow through change with clarity and confidence. Her latest book, The New Old, applies her wisdom to aging well and crafting your best later life. Ep 47From Newsroom to Clean Living: Sarah Clark on Healthier Homes and Everyday Choices
Check Out These Highlights: Many women build lives that look successful from the outside, only to realize something feels off on the inside. For Sarah, that realization came when her son’s sensitive skin reacted to “natural” products that weren’t as safe as they claimed. She shares how digging into hidden ingredients and the lack of regulation in personal care products opened her eyes to the bigger picture: the everyday exposures in our homes that quietly affect our health. From switching out cookware and food storage to teaching her kids how to read labels, Sarah explains how small, manageable shifts can make a big difference. Her experience as a breast cancer survivor deepened her perspective on resilience and clarified why environmental factors deserve more attention in health conversations. Throughout the episode, Sarah speaks candidly about identity, self‑trust, and the emotional work of making changes, while also offering practical advice for reducing toxins without feeling like it has to be “all or nothing.” If you’ve been curious about clean living or felt overwhelmed by conflicting information, this episode is a reminder that healthier choices are possible one step at a time. About Sarah Clark: Sarah Clark is the founder of Better Health with Sarah, where she helps families cut through the overwhelm of clean living and take practical steps to reduce harmful chemicals in their homes, products, and diets. As a breast cancer survivor and former TV reporter, she combines her love of educating with a grounded perspective on resilience, identity, and the everyday choices that shape long‑term health.
